TL;DR
Icon has partnered with Anthropic to deploy Claude AI in clinical trials, aiming to improve operational efficiency. Specific applications, deployment scope, and validation details remain unconfirmed.
Icon has signed an agreement with Anthropic to deploy the company’s Claude artificial intelligence system in clinical trials, marking a move to incorporate generative AI into drug development processes. The announcement confirms the partnership but does not specify which trials, tasks, or deployment schedules are involved, nor whether the rollout will be phased or broad.
The deal connects Icon’s clinical trial operations with Anthropic’s Claude models. The announcement does not identify which specific Claude model will be used, nor the scope of applications such as document handling, data retrieval, or workflow support. Neither the participating trials nor the geographic regions have been disclosed.
Details about the tasks Claude will perform remain unspecified, and it is unclear whether the system will handle patient data, regulatory records, or internal documents. The agreement also does not include information on financial terms, exclusivity, validation procedures, or controls governing AI-generated outputs, raising questions about compliance and safety in regulated environments.

Background of AI Use in Clinical Trials
Generative AI has been explored by developers and research organizations for automating document management, data summarization, and administrative tasks in clinical research. Prior efforts have focused on internal workflows, with limited public disclosures about validated applications in regulated environments. Anthropic’s Claude models are among the latest AI systems developed for general-purpose language tasks, but their specific use in clinical trials has not been previously confirmed.
Icon has been expanding its digital capabilities for trial management, and this partnership signals a move toward adopting advanced AI tools to streamline operations. However, the industry remains cautious about AI’s role in decision-making, especially regarding patient safety and regulatory compliance.
